12.04.010 Adopted
The Parks, Golf and Open Space Plan, including
the Master Development Plan for Foster Golf Links, as
prepared, is hereby adopted as the Parks, Golf and
Open Space Plan for the City of Tukwila.
(Ord. 1959 §1, 2001)

12.04.020 Authentication--Recordation--Availability
A copy of the plan, in the form adopted by this
ordinance, shall be authenticated and recorded by the
City Clerk along with this ordinance and, pursuant to
RCW 35A.12.140, not less than one copy of such
documents shall be filed in the office of the City Clerk
for use and examination by the public.
(Ord. 1959 §2, 2001)

12.04.030 Filing
A copy of the ordinance codified herein and the
Parks, Golf and Open Space Plan shall be filed with the
following City departments:
1. Community Development;
2. Public Works Department;
3. Finance Department;
4. Parks and Recreation Department.
5. Mayor's Office.
(Ord. 1959 §3, 2001)

12.04.040 Six-Year Master Plan for Foster Golf


Course
A. The Foster Golf Links Revised Six-Year Master
Plan Update dated June 28, 1999 is hereby adopted.
B. The Foster Golf Links Revised Six-Year Master
Plan will be a component in the Park, Golf and Public
Places Plan when that document is completed.
(Ord. 1882 §1, 1999)

12.12.020 Residential Fee Eligibility
In order to be eligible for Residential Fees, the indi- 12.12.090 Inclusion of Taxes in Greens Fees
vidual must present identification to prove they reside All greens fees as established by this ordinance
within the City limits of Tukwila. Eligibility cards will include the City’s Admissions Tax and State Sales Tax
be issued to qualifying individuals by the Foster Golf within the stated amount.
Links Pro Shop covering a period from January 1 to (Ord. 1930 §10, 2000)
December 31 for each year. Cards may only be used
by the individual resident during the year issued.
(Ord. 1930 §2, 2000)

12.12.030 “Extra Hole” Charge


An “Extra Hole” fee shall be charged when a player
desires to play an additional 9 holes after the first 9-
hole fee has been paid. The amount of the Extra Hole
fee shall be the difference between the 9-hole and 18-
hole fee for the particular player.
(Ord. 1930 §3, 2000)

12.12.040 “Twilight” Fee


A “Twilight” fee of one-half the Non-Residential 9-
hole fee, weekday or weekend rate as applicable, shall
be charged to all golfers one hour before the official
sundown time or when there is not enough time to
complete nine holes. Twilight fee applies to golfers of
all ages and categories. Official sundown time shall be
as stated in the Nautical Almanac, U.S. Naval
Observatory for Seattle, Washington.
(Ord. 1930 §4, 2000)
